The Vaccination Drive for 500 Children is currently in progress, with a total project goal of $10,000. To date, the project has received $10 in donations from 1 donor, leaving $9,990 remaining to fully fund the initiative. No monthly donors have been secured yet.
The funds raised so far represent an important first contribution toward providing life-saving vaccinations to children in underserved communities across Nigeria. However, approximately 99.9% of the project funding requirement remains outstanding, making continued fundraising essential to achieve the planned target of vaccinating 500 children.
With additional financial support, the project will expand outreach activities, facilitate access to vaccines through organized community initiatives, provide parents with essential immunization information, and support proper vaccination records and follow-up. Every contribution will help move the project closer to protecting vulnerable children from preventable diseases and strengthening community confidence in routine immunization.
We remain committed to mobilizing donors and partners to close the remaining $9,990 funding gap and deliver the intended health impact to 500 children.
